Have a customer with a 9000mfp that is getting 13.12.02 & 0C phantom jams.
When the jam occurs display says to open the left side; move the finisher and open the door to the duplexer/fuser area, close the door and move back the finisher and the job then continues. The jam occurs between 1 and 20 to 1 in 500 pages. I got the jam to occur only twice, the .02 and a .0C jam. I could not find any paper from the fuser exit, duplexer and in the finisher except in the tray where it belongs.
Did blow out a ton of dust and other debris. What I would like to know is where is the sensor(s) that throw this error. Any ideas?
